Eco-huqin ensembles to celebrate the art of bowed-string chamber musicThe Eco-huqin series developed by the HKCO has now a proven track record of success and open endorsements. The quartet made up of the four huqin principals of the Orchestra won rave response at the Singapore Huayi – Chinese Festival of Arts 2013 performing on these instruments, and in the last two seasons, the two quartets made up of huqin virtuosi of the Orchestra, Bravura Strings and 3+1, have made their brilliant debuts and proved their mettle. This concert therefore features an all-bowed-string programme performed by ensembles in different configurations. The huqin is world famous for its human-voice qualities and mellifluous tones that appeal to all tastes. It would be doubly charming in this ecologically developed version – so stay tuned.
